The Mile-Hi Farmers” Market in Albuquerque, NM, offers a vibrant and community-focused shopping experience during the warmer months from spring through fall. Open exclusively on Sundays from 10:00 AM to 2:00 PM, it provides residents and visitors a chance to purchase fresh, locally sourced produce and artisanal goods in a lively outdoor setting. With a strong reputation reflected in its 4.6-star rating from over 1,150 reviews, this market is a favorite destination for those seeking quality and supporting local farmers and artisans. Whether you”re looking for seasonal fruits and vegetables, baked goods, or handcrafted items, the Mile-Hi Farmers” Market is a cornerstone of Albuquerque”s local food scene.
